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Kirkby-in-Ashfield to Curriehill start from as little as £26.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Kirkby-in-Ashfield to Curriehill start from £177.20 one way, or £178.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Kirkby-in-Ashfield to Curriehill are available for £186.90 one way, or £373.70 return

Facilities at Kirkby-in-Ashfield Station

The station is equipped with essential amenities, ensuring a smooth travel experience. Although there isn't a ticket office, travelers can easily purchase and collect pre-bought tickets from the available ticket machines, which are designed to accommodate all users, including those with accessibility needs. Smartcard users will find validators on site; however, issuing of new smartcards is not available here.

For passengers needing assistance, the station is ready to address inquiries via a help point. While staff assistance isn't directly available, a robust lost property service ensures misplaced items are duly handled. Security is a priority with CCTV coverage providing an additional layer of comfort.

Accessibility

Travelers should note that Kirkby-in-Ashfield station categorizes as a Category C station, meaning it does not offer step-free access to platforms, unlike neighboring stations like Mansfield. Yet, tactile paving at the platform edges provides vital cues for those with visual impairments. It's crucial for those requiring specific access needs to plan their journey accordingly, potentially utilizing other stations with better facilities if necessary.

Facilities and Accessibility

Designed with simplicity in mind, Curriehill lacks some modern conveniences but compensates with basic necessities. The station does not feature a ticket office or ticket machines, so travelers are encouraged to purchase their tickets online in advance. Although this might seem like a hurdle, it offers a blissful escape from the usual hustle and bustle. Despite the absence of a ticket collection point, the station does provide smartcard validators, ensuring a seamless check-in process for smartcard users. Rest assured with the presence of CCTV for added safety, although staff assistance is unavailable—meaning, any queries or help would need to be sought ahead of your journey.

Accessing the station is relatively straightforward with step-free access available to platform 2, though travellers should be wary of a more pronounced stepping distance when boarding from this platform. There are also two Blue Badge parking bays available for those needing accessible parking, and the car park boasts 39 free spaces overall, making it an economical choice for drivers. Onsite amenities are limited, with no available shops, ATMs, or refreshment facilities. It's advisable to plan accordingly and come prepared with necessities in tow.

Onward Travel Options

Despite its modest size, Curriehill ensures travelers are not left stranded. Rail replacement services are facilitated from the station car park, with details available on the ///what3words platform. While taxis aren't stationed at Curriehill itself, they can be easily arranged via traintaxi.co.uk. For more extensive travel options, check out Traveline Scotland for comprehensive bus service information.
